#ifndef CONFIG_H
#define CONFIG_H
#include <variant>
#include <string>
#include <QString>
#include <unordered_map>
#include <tuple>
#include "toml/toml/value.hpp"
namespace Config
{
struct LegacyEntry
{
char Name[32];
int Type; // 0=int 1=bool 2=string 3=64bit int
char TOMLPath[64];
bool InstanceUnique; // whether the setting can exist individually for each instance in multiplayer
};
template<typename T>
using DefaultList = std::unordered_map<std::string, T>;
using RangeList = std::unordered_map<std::string, std::tuple<int, int>>;
class Table;
class Array
{
public:
Array(toml::value& data);
~Array() {}
size_t Size();
void Clear();
Array GetArray(const int id);
int GetInt(const int id);
int64_t GetInt64(const int id);
bool GetBool(const int id);
std::string GetString(const int id);
void SetInt(const int id, int val);
void SetInt64(const int id, int64_t val);
void SetBool(const int id, bool val);
void SetString(const int id, const std::string& val);
// convenience
QString GetQString(const int id)
{
return QString::fromStdString(GetString(id));
}
void SetQString(const int id, const QString& val)
{
return SetString(id, val.toStdString());
}
private:
toml::value& Data;
};
class Table
{
public:
//Table();
Table(toml::value& data, const std::string& path);
~Table() {}
Table& operator=(const Table& b);
Array GetArray(const std::string& path);
Table GetTable(const std::string& path, const std::string& defpath = "");
int GetInt(const std::string& path);
int64_t GetInt64(const std::string& path);
bool GetBool(const std::string& path);
std::string GetString(const std::string& path);
void SetInt(const std::string& path, int val);
void SetInt64(const std::string& path, int64_t val);
void SetBool(const std::string& path, bool val);
void SetString(const std::string& path, const std::string& val);
// convenience
QString GetQString(const std::string& path)
{
return QString::fromStdString(GetString(path));
}
void SetQString(const std::string& path, const QString& val)
{
return SetString(path, val.toStdString());
}
private:
toml::value& Data;
std::string PathPrefix;
toml::value& ResolvePath(const std::string& path);
template<typename T> T FindDefault(const std::string& path, T def, DefaultList<T> list);
};
bool Load();
void Save();
Table GetLocalTable(int instance);
inline Table GetGlobalTable() { return GetLocalTable(-1); }
}
#endif // CONFIG_H
